comparison src/os/win32/ngx_files.h @ 571:458b6c3fea65 release-0.3.7

nginx-0.3.7-RELEASE import *) Feature: the "access_log" supports the "buffer=" parameter. *) Bugfix: nginx could not be built on platforms different from i386, amd64, sparc, and ppc; the bug had appeared in 0.3.2.
author Igor Sysoev <igor@sysoev.ru>
date Thu, 27 Oct 2005 15:46:13 +0000
parents d4ea69372b94
children f971949ffb58
comparison
equal deleted inserted replaced
570:2cdf120d8970 571:458b6c3fea65
61 #define ngx_open_tempfile_n "CreateFile()" 61 #define ngx_open_tempfile_n "CreateFile()"
62 62
63 63
64 #define ngx_close_file CloseHandle 64 #define ngx_close_file CloseHandle
65 #define ngx_close_file_n "CloseHandle()" 65 #define ngx_close_file_n "CloseHandle()"
66
67
68 #define ngx_write_fd(fd, buf, size) WriteFile(fd, buf, size, NULL, NULL)
69 #define ngx_linefeed(p) *p++ = CR; *p++ = LF;
70 #define NGX_LINEFEED_SIZE 2
66 71
67 72
68 #define ngx_delete_file(name) DeleteFile((const char *) name) 73 #define ngx_delete_file(name) DeleteFile((const char *) name)
69 #define ngx_delete_file_n "DeleteFile()" 74 #define ngx_delete_file_n "DeleteFile()"
70 75